Unstable oil pump pressure at the reciprocating compressor shaft head

What causes unstable pressure in the oil pump at the reciprocating compressor shaft head? It is adjusted to 3 kilograms, and then slowly, over about an hour, it drops to 2.4 kilograms; after that it suddenly rises back to 3 kilograms, and this cycle repeats. What is the reason for this?

Oil pressure is affected by oil temperature, which in turn is influenced by factors such as the amount of water circulating and water pressure; Change in oil filter pressure difference ; Fault in the shaft head oil pump operation. Explore various aspects to find the cause.

With the oil temperature stable and unchanged, the oil pressure is fluctuating. Moreover, after one cycle, the oil pressure rises instantly, which rules out the influence of oil temperature on viscosity ;
